25 yearsThis July 4th the Sodus Bay Lighthouse Museum celebrates 25 years since opening to the public on July 4th 1985. Come celebrate with us!

Our Weekend Activities Schedule is once again filled with Concerts spanning the weeks of our Summer Season beginning with a July 4th Concert by the Gap Mangione Big Band and ending with a Traditional Labor Day Concert by the Rhythm Aces Big Band.

Our afternoon concerts are presented at the Lighthouse Gazebo with lawn seating in the village park adjacent to the Museum. Please plan to join us! The Concerts are free, and we serve the finest grilled hot dogs and sausages that you have ever tasted from our volunteer staffed food line, both before and during the concerts.
